Adrian Morley (born 10 May 1977 in Salford, England) is a professional rugby league footballer for the Warrington Wolves of Super League. A Great Britain and England international representative prop forward, he previously played for the Leeds Rhinos (winning the Challenge Cup with them in 1999), Australia's Sydney Roosters (with whom he won the 2002 NRL Premiership), and Bradford Bulls (with whom he won 2005's Super League X), before moving to Warrington (with whom he won the Challenge Cup in 2009 and 2010).
Morley played for Leeds between 1996 and 2000. Although also eligible for the Welsh national team, he made his England and Great Britain debuts in 1996. In the 1997 post season, Morley was selected to play for Great Britain in all three matches of the Super League Test series against Australia. Morley won the Challenge Cup with Leeds in 1999 when they defeated the London Broncos 52 - 16 at Wembley Stadium. He was offered a chance to play alongside his brother Chris Morley in the 2000 World Cup, who played for Wales but chose to commit to England.
